About The Position

The Revenue & Cost Operations Analyst is responsible for the accuracy and integrity of Masterworks’ financial data, from client-specific budget models and invoicing, through internal revenue projections, reconciliations, and cost of goods sold (COGS) reporting. This role lives inside our record-keeping tools, translating complex account-level financial models into numbers that both clients and internal leadership can trust. It requires close partnership with every business unit to keep accrual-based accounting current, reconciled, and audit-ready. This role does not manage people. It manages the accuracy, consistency, and integrity of Masterworks’ financial data across every account and business unit.

Responsibilities

  • Partner with every business unit to collect and validate COGS data on a recurring cadence
  • Ensure accrual-based accounting entries are recorded accurately and on schedule
  • Reconcile COGS and accrual entries against actuals, resolving discrepancies with business unit leads
  • Support month-end and quarter-end close processes with accurate COGS and accrual reporting
  • Maintain and validate internal revenue projection models, ensuring assumptions reflect current account activity
  • Reconcile projected revenue against actuals on a recurring monthly basis, flagging and resolving variances
  • Support finance leadership with accurate, up-to-date revenue reporting for forecasting and planning
  • Identify and correct data inconsistencies across proformas, invoicing records, and revenue models
  • Navigate and maintain client budget model worksheets, ensuring formulas, assumptions, and account-level detail remain accurate
  • Verify client invoices tie back to projections and contracted scopes of work before they go out
  • Investigate and resolve discrepancies between budgeted projections and actual billing
  • Partner with account teams to update budget models as scopes, budgets, or timelines change
  • Maintain consistent templates, naming conventions, and version control across client budget models
